2008.8 : Can receive calls but cannot call
Hi everyone, I thought I give a try and install 2008.8. I had a certain number of problems : 1) Pin isn't asked for each time (4-5 reboots), even if I launch an application which needs PIN (dialer). 2) Dialer says No network on each call, whereas I succesfully entered my PIN. 3) I can receive calls, and just after that, I can't call !
